Amina Mass Rape Case Thrown Out of Court

Source: citifmonline.com

An Accra High Court has quashed the case in which Amina Mohammed, the woman at the centre of an alleged mass rape of passengers on a Tamale bound Yutong bus.

The High Court judge struck out the case for lack of evidence.

Amina, who made the allegation of the mass rape on a Yutong bus at Kubiase, stood trial on two counts of causing fear and panic and deceit of public officer. She pleaded not guilty.

She was arrested in October 2010 in the wake of a highway robbery incident at Kintampo in which she claimed the robbers ordered the male passengers to rape their female counterparts.

The police charged her after investigation, claiming the rape case never occurred in the first place.**
